Overview

The 2011 Atlanta Smart Pig Project - MLV 80B40/41 is an operational gas pipeline facility near Butler, Alabama, USA. It is part of pipeline infrastructure regulated under PHMSA and DOT 49 CFR Part 192.

The 2011 Atlanta Smart Pig Project - MLV 80B40/41 is a gas pipeline facility located approximately 3.80 miles northeast of Butler, in Choctaw County, Alabama, United States. This facility is part of the broader natural gas transmission infrastructure serving the southeastern US. As a gas pipeline, it operates under the regulatory oversight of the Pipeline and Hazardous Materials Safety Administration (PHMSA) and complies with DOT 49 CFR Part 192, which governs gas pipeline safety. The facility is classified under NAICS code 486210 (Pipeline Transportation of Natural Gas). The pipeline likely transports natural gas from production areas to distribution networks, supporting regional energy needs. Operationally, this facility plays a role in the natural gas supply chain, contributing to energy reliability for communities and industries in Alabama and neighboring states. The pipeline's location in a rural area reduces population density risks, but proximity to waterways and agricultural land requires ongoing monitoring and maintenance to ensure environmental protection.

Environmental context

The facility is situated in a rural area of Choctaw County, Alabama, characterized by forests, farmland, and waterways. Pipeline operations in such environments require careful management to prevent leaks or ruptures that could impact soil and water quality. The commodity transported (natural gas) poses risks of methane emissions and combustion hazards. Regulatory compliance under PHMSA includes leak detection, corrosion control, and emergency response plans to mitigate environmental risks.
